Why Choose February

February is a lovely time for a Bermuda honeymoon, especially if you want a peaceful escape with mild weather and plenty of space to yourselves. Days are generally comfortable for exploring, while the island’s famous beaches, clear water and colourful streets provide a memorable setting for newlywed adventures.

It is also a quieter period than the main summer season. That means you can enjoy relaxed meals, uncrowded viewpoints and leisurely walks without feeling rushed. Pack light layers for cooler evenings, and you will be ready for everything from a sunny coastal stroll to a candlelit dinner.

Romantic Island Days

Bermuda’s beaches are ideal for slow honeymoon mornings. Walk hand in hand across the soft sand at Horseshoe Bay, find a sheltered spot at Elbow Beach, or simply sit together and watch the changing colours of the Atlantic. The sea may be too cool for some swimmers in February, but the scenery is beautiful and the quieter atmosphere is wonderfully romantic.

For a different view, take a gentle coastal walk along the South Shore. Stop for photographs, share a picnic and let the day unfold at its own pace. Hiring a scooter or booking a private tour makes it easy to discover small coves, historic forts and peaceful corners beyond the main resorts.

Explore Hamilton And Beyond

Hamilton is a great place to spend an afternoon together. Browse independent shops, admire the pastel-coloured buildings and pause for coffee or lunch overlooking the harbour. February is well suited to sightseeing, as the cooler temperatures make it comfortable to explore on foot.

Make time for Bermuda’s history too. Visit the Royal Naval Dockyard, explore the National Museum of Bermuda and wander through St George’s,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. The island’s compact size means you can combine culture, scenery and a relaxed meal in one enjoyable day.

Honeymoon Experiences

A February honeymoon in Bermuda is about enjoying simple moments together. Book a harbour-side dinner, arrange a sunset cruise if conditions are calm, or treat yourselves to a couples’ spa visit. Local seafood, fresh produce and Bermudian specialities add something distinctive to your evenings.

When planning your trip, choose accommodation that suits the pace you want, whether that is a stylish hotel near Hamilton or a peaceful resort by the coast.
